Wool rugs
Wool rugs are unique because their texture allows them
to recover easily from crushing. Crushing occurs when furniture pushes
down a carpet's fibers. Wool rugs also resist soiling and are relatively
easy to clean.
Wool rugs are resistant to dirt and release it up to 25 percent more
easily than other fibers. The outer layer of the wool features a waxed
surface to keep soil from embedding itself deep into the carpet. The
waxed surface also keeps water from entering and penetrating the wool
fibers.
